Understanding the specifics for Pennsylvania is your first step. The Commonwealth has strict regulations on payday lending. In fact, traditional storefront payday loans with their extremely high annual percentage rates (APRs) are not legally permitted in Pennsylvania. What you will find marketed as an "instant" loan are often installment loans or other forms of short-term credit from licensed lenders. These loans are capped by state law, which means lenders cannot charge exorbitant fees that trap borrowers in cycles of debt. Before applying for any quick-cash product, verify the lender is licensed with the Pennsylvania Department of Banking and Securities. This is your best defense against predatory online lenders that may not comply with state laws.
